TPWallet最新版“账号资源不足”问题:全面解读与实操建议

导言:随着去中心化应用和链上交互增多,用户在使用TPWallet等轻钱包时会遇到“账号资源不足”或费用/权限受限的情形。本文从实时资产保护、合约应用、专业分析、智能化创新、隐私保护与备份策略六个维度,给出成因判断与可落地的解决方案。

一、问题成因与专业见解分析

1) 常见成因:链上手续费不足(ETH、BSC等需Gas)、代币授权耗尽、账户额度/资源(如EOS/Tron类链的CPU/NET/RAM)被耗尽、合约限制或Nonce异常、RPC节点差异导致状态不同步。网络拥堵和合约逻辑复杂度也会放大资源消耗。

2) 风险评估:账号资源不足不仅导致交易失败,还可能造成中断性挂起(交易重试浪费Gas)、授权被滥用或出现回滚,严重时影响资金安全与资产可用性。

二、实时资产保护(实操要点)

- 预警与监控:开启即时通知(交易失败、余额低于阈值),结合钱包内或第三方监控服务设置最小余额提醒。

- 分层资产管理:将高频交易资产放热钱包、长期存储放冷钱包或多签;设定每日/每笔限额并启用交易审批。

- 交易前模拟与Gas估算:使用钱包的模拟器功能或靠谱RPC预估Gas,避免因估算不准导致连续失败。

三、合约应用与应对策略

- 权限与授权管理:定期审查并收回不必要的Token Allowance;对重要合约使用时间或数量限制的授权策略。

- 费用代付与MetaTx:使用代付(Relayer)或meta-transaction方案,让dApp或第三方代付Gas,缓解用户短期资源不足问题,但需信任或审计代付方。

- 合约优化:开发者应优化合约调用路径,减少跨合约调用次数和状态写入,降低Gas消耗。

四、智能化创新模式(可落地的产品思路)

- 预测补给引擎:基于用户行为与链上数据的AI模型预测何时会耗尽资源,自动发起提示或小额代充值。

- 自动化流动性/燃料池:钱包内嵌“燃料池”或自动从备用资产(如稳定币)兑换Gas,结合止损与滑点控制。

- 机器学习风控:实时识别异常交易模式并触发多因素验证或临时锁定。

五、隐私保护与合规考量

- 本地优先:私钥、助记词和签名操作应始终优先在本地设备完成,最小化外发敏感数据。

- 元数据最小化:请求dApp权限时限制暴露账户相关元数据;使用一键生成的新地址或子账户以降低关联性。

- 网络匿名性:必要时结合Tor/VPN或隐私中继来降低请求追踪,但注意性能和RPC兼容性。

六、备份策略与恢复流程

- 多重备份:助记词离线纸质保存、加密电子备份(如带密码的文件)与硬件钱包分散保存。

- 社交恢复与阈值分割:采用Shamir分片或社交恢复机制,把恢复信息分布给可信联系人或多台设备,既方便恢复又提高安全性。

- 定期演练:定期在隔离环境中演练恢复流程,确认备份可用性与流程熟悉度。

七、实用应急操作清单(遇到资源不足时)

1) 不要反复重发失败事务;2) 切换更快或更可靠的RPC;3) 使用代付/Relayer或向已信任地址临时转入少量Gas;4) 检查合约授权并收回异常权限;5) 如怀疑被攻击,立即转移核心资产到冷钱包并开始恢复流程。

结语:TPWallet遇到“账号资源不足”是多因素叠加的结果,既需要用户端的良好习惯(分层管理、定期审查、备份演练),也需要钱包与dApp提供智能化支持(预测补给、代付方案与实时风控)。在提高可用性的同时,隐私与安全不能妥协:所有自动化和代付设计都应纳入可审计、最小权限与用户可控的原则。

作者:林墨发布时间:2026-02-09 01:10:46

评论

CryptoKid

文章很实用,特别是预测补给和燃料池的思路,值得钱包开发者参考。

小李

学到了,之前被gas卡死好几次,回去要把代币授权都清查一遍。

BlueSky

关于隐私那一节写得好,metadata问题经常被忽略。

张晴

社交恢复和Shamir分片的建议非常实用,已经准备开始做备份演练。

相关阅读